Biography:
Hannah M. Redwine is a second year medical student at the Orlando College of Osteopathic Medicine in Winter Garden, Florida, United States. She serves as President of the Student American Academy of Osteopathy at her institution and is actively involved in teaching OMM and mentoring peers. Her academic interests include the role of Osteopathic Manipulative Medicine in neuropsychiatry, palliative care, and integrative approaches to chronic illness. She has completed advanced training in the Fascial Distortion Model and in cranial osteopathy from the Osteopathic Cranial Academy, is certified in Palliative Care and is committed to advancing holistic, patient-centered care through both clinical practice and research.
